Hello markst.
This abnormality that you have detected on the TV menu. Dose it also affect the picture? Is it just the menu? Is it on all the inputs (HDMI, s-video, component cable, vga, etc)?
You see the only board in charge of the TV menu is the DMD board, if those slight curves are just affecting the menu, I don’t think you should worry much, but if it also starts to affect the picture you should consider replacing the DMD. If it only affects the HDMI & vga cable, it’s the digital video board that probably gone bad. If it’s the others then it’s the analog video board.
